Playing for a Cure Game Raises $6000 for ACS!

Some good news to share from the 6th annual “Playing for a Cure” games, hosted in February. Our St Joes Boys and Girls Basketball programs once again battled crosstown rivals, Trumbull, raising $6000 to benefit the American Cancer Society. In addition to providing exciting conference play, the goal of the games is to raise money for the American Cancer Society via the "Officials vs Cancer" platform. The SJ community was there in full force to support & cheer on our athletes, and the cause. Our donation allows the American Cancer Society to help people facing cancer today and find cures to end the disease tomorrow.
